## Runbook: Account Recovery — Gatewise Turnstile Counter

So the Gatewise counter service at Harrowfield Stadium occasionally loses its admin account after a firmware rollback — annoying, but recoverable. For your review: the recovery flow requires physical presence at the north control room, a second operator sign-off, and an entry in the gate-ops log. No remote recovery is permitted, ever. Once both operators have signed, the admin account is restored by entering the recovery passphrase below.

vault phrase of fafop-kagug = zorox-zorwyn

## Runbook: Gaugepile Sidecar — Release Checklist

Heads up: the sidecar ships with every app pod, so a bad config fans out fast. Before cutting a release, confirm the flush interval hasn't drifted from what the Tallyhouse aggregator expects, or you'll see sawtooth gaps in dashboards. Rollbacks are cheap — just repin the image tag. Canary one node pool first, watch for ten minutes, then proceed. The values to verify against are these.

config for bagep-yafof:
quenath:
  pin: 8584
  metrics_host: metrics.quenath.tolvaqsys.internal
  tenant: pelath
  seal: seal_ed102645

Leadership Review Briefing — Regional Sales

The Carsten Valley region finished the half-year two points under target, offset by strong renewals in Northgate. Pipeline coverage stands at 2.8x for next quarter. Sales leads should prepare territory-level commentary before the review. One item below is restricted to attendees of this session.

internal memo for tajof-kagef: The western region missed its Ulaius quota by 32.0 percent last quarter. Kasoxek Freight plans to lower the Eliiel list price by 64.7 percent in November. The board signed off on a budget of $266.8 million for Project Istwyn. The renewal with Wenmirix Logistics closes at $502.9 million a year, 11.8 percent below the last contract.

Facilities ticket — Halewick Tower, night shift.

Issue: support team reporting east stairwell reader rejecting badges after midnight. Reader was reset this morning; firmware updated. Overnight crew should now badge as normal. If the reader fails again, use the manual keypad by the fire door — do not prop the door. Log any further failures with the time and badge name. Temporary keypad code for the fallback door is below.

door code, tajeg-fawip: bdg-K-62